Output c61b0a8e30c80b6aa1d5b06f7c22fd606326f7db8dd49cf5962fc34318744002:0

value
3767538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75cc1ca4c89240bc373dea04a53a6d1affdbf17b OP_EQUAL
address
3CRsVvvqgNgGwaEhXLyb3BSRytwfdr1WsB
transaction
c61b0a8e30c80b6aa1d5b06f7c22fd606326f7db8dd49cf5962fc34318744002
confirmations
337678
spent
true